Allright, I'm not trying to be a hater, but if you think UCLA wins by 10 or 11 and the spread is UCLA -12 why buy two points and then take the Bruins at -10 which you just said was a push? Why not just take WKU or buy two points to get them at +14? Anyway, UCLA has trouble scoring, Love is the only consistent threat (but he's a pretty good one) but they play lockdown D. WKU can shoot and score but doesn't have the defensive presence that A&M could bring. I think the way to beat UCLA is play tough and physical and hope you eek out more points than they do (like A&M almost did). I don't think WKU can play that way so I don't give them much of a chance here... Unless they shoot 50% from the 3 and 54% from the floor like they did against Drake. Unfortunately for the Toppers, UCLA plays MUCH MUCH better D than the Drake 'Dogs do so they will likely be limited to more earthly numbers. Still 12 points is a lot of points for a UCLA team that struggles with its offense and is still working M'Bah A Moute (I'm sure I butchered that spelling) into the system. I like the Bruins by less than 10 with Brazleton and Lee shooting enough to keep the game close, but not enough to win.

UCLA 1st half defense 27.42 points allowed 20th in the country
WKU 1st half defense 30.77 points allowed 118th in the country
Level of competition that those numbers were compiled against not even close. UCLA had games against Texas, Maryland (which was ranked at the time) Michigan State, Davidson, and the PAC-10.
Wetern Kentucky had games against Gonzaga, and Tennessee, losing both. Neither one of those teams comes near UCLA defensively. Tennessee is a program built upon outscoring the opponent, UCLA is built on stopping the opponent. Ben Howland has seen it all before, and he will have his troops ready to play tonight, as the roll in the 1st half, and get a lead of 10 to take into the 2nd half.
The level of competition is uneven and the talent of the Bruins will show in th enumber of missed threes by WKU. UCLA has some of the best on the ball defenders in the nation.
